/**
* Base object for all Json objects in Tachyon.
*/
abstract class JsonObject {
/** Creates a JSON ObjectMapper configured not to close the underlying stream. */
public static ObjectMapper createObjectMapper() {
// TODO: Could disable field name quoting, though this would produce technically invalid JSON
// See: JsonGenerator.QUOTE_FIELD_NAMES and JsonParser.ALLOW_UNQUOTED_FIELD_NAMES
return new ObjectMapper().configure(JsonGenerator.Feature.AUTO_CLOSE_TARGET, false).configure(
SerializationFeature.CLOSE_CLOSEABLE, false);
}
public Map<String, Object> parameters = Maps.newHashMap();
/**
* Generic parameter getter, useful for custom classes or enums.
* Use a more specific getter, like getLong(), when available.
*/
@SuppressWarnings("unchecked")
public <T> T get(String name) {
return (T) parameters.get(name);
}
public Boolean getBoolean(String name) {
return this.get(name);
}
/** Deserializes a base64-encoded String as a ByteBuffer. */
public ByteBuffer getByteBuffer(String name) {
String byteString = get(name);
if (byteString == null) {
return null;
}
return ByteBuffer.wrap(Base64.decodeBase64(byteString));
}
/** Deserializes a list of base64-encoded Strings as a list of ByteBuffers. */
public List<ByteBuffer> getByteBufferList(String name) {
List<String> byteStrings = get(name);
if (byteStrings == null) {
return null;
}
List<ByteBuffer> buffers = Lists.newArrayListWithCapacity(byteStrings.size());
for (String byteString : byteStrings) {
buffers.add(ByteBuffer.wrap(Base64.decodeBase64(byteString)));
}
return buffers;
}
public Integer getInt(String name) {
return this.<Number> get(name).intValue();
}
/**
* Deserializes the parameter as a long.
* Use of this function is necessary when dealing with longs, as they may
* have been deserialized as integers if they were sufficiently small.
*/
public Long getLong(String name) {
return this.<Number> get(name).longValue();
}
public String getString(String name) {
return this.get(name);
}
/** Adds the given named parameter to the Json object. Value must be JSON-serializable. */
public JsonObject withParameter(String name, Object value) {
parameters.put(name, value);
return this;
}
}
